Stop!

July 6, 2012

Life is a busy enterprise. It seems there are always more things to do, places to go, and people to meet. And while none of us would want a life without meaningful things to do, the fast pace threatens to rob us of the quietness that we need.

When we’re driving a car, stop signs and other signs warning us to slow down are reminders that to be safe we can’t have our foot on the accelerator all the time. We need those kinds of reminders in all aspects of our lives.

The psalmist clearly knew the importance of times of calm and quiet. God Himself “rested” on the seventh day. And with more messages to preach and more people to heal, Jesus went apart from the crowds and rested a while (Matt. 14:13; Mark 6:31). He knew it wasn’t wise to accelerate through life with our gas gauge registering on “weary” all the time.

When was the last time you could echo the psalmist’s words, “I have calmed and quieted my soul”? (Ps. 131:2). Put up a stop sign at the intersection of your busy life. Find a place to be alone. Turn off the distractions that keep you from listening to God’s voice, and let Him speak to you as you read His Word. Let Him refresh your heart and mind with the strength to live life well for His glory.

Life can make me weary and stressed at times.
I want to stop right now though, Lord, and take the time
to quiet my soul before You. Speak to me from
Your Word. Please refresh me.
Stop and take a break from the busyness of life so that you can refuel your soul.

Read: Psalm 131

I have calmed and quieted my soul, like a weaned child with his mother; like a weaned child is my soul within me. —Psalm 131:2

THE SOLDIER’S CODE




Gen Dwight D. Eisenhower addresses troops of the 101st Airborne Division 5Jun1944 prior to D-Day Normandy

The Soldier’s Code

1) I am an American fighting man. I serve in the forces which guard my country and our way of life. I am prepared to give my life in their defense.

2) I will never surrender of my own free will. If in command, I will never surrender my men while they still have the means to resist.

3) If I am captured, I will continue to resist by all means available. I will make every effort to escape and aid others to escape. I will accept neither parole nor special favors from the enemy.

4) If I become a prisoner of war, I will keep faith with my fellow prisoners. I will give no information or take part in any action which might be harmful to my comrades. If I am senior, I will take command. If not, I will obey the lawful orders of those appointed over me, and will back them up in every way.

5) When questioned, should I become a prisoner of war, I am bound to give only name, rank, service number, and date of birth. I will evade answering further questions to the utmost of my ability. I will make no oral or written statements disloyal to my country and its allies, or harmful to their cause.

6) I will never forget that I am an American fighting man, responsible for my actions, and dedicated to the principles which made my country free. I will trust in my God and in the United States of America.

President Dwight D. Eisenhower, August, 1955.
